Transaction 59eca36802e7dc60654592be4f506287c525ffaea6cd40ecc4b69e1dfe4594a7
1 Input
1 Output
-
59eca36802e7dc60654592be4f506287c525ffaea6cd40ecc4b69e1dfe4594a7:0
- value
- 318600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27346461ce5c6143e9e9e08d0bb038c28aa79b6e OP_EQUAL
- address
- 35GK3HxqE4kVRRK66BVoJXx8Jt8CWnocnj